A life-threatening three-month-old child from Ogliastra was transported on an urgent flight to Genoa.

The transfer was carried out with a Falcon 900 of the thirty-first wing of the Italian Air Force which took off at 3 pm today from Elmas airport.

The doctors of the Brotzu hospital in Cagliari, having found the complex clinical picture of the little patient, requested emergency transport to the Gaslini children's hospital.

The life-saving flight was arranged and coordinated by the top situation room of the command of the Air Force, the operations room of the Air Force which also has among its tasks that of activating and managing urgent medical transport.
